- Please tell me how to start up VMware Tools and how to check its operation?Public Catalog
If you are using Red Hat Enterprise Linux Server 5/6 or later, please check its status by the procedures below.
Also, please start up VMware Tools if it is down.If you are using Red Hat Enterprise Linux Server 5:
How to check VMware Tools status:
# ps -ef | grep vmtools # service vmware-tools status # ps -ef | grep vmtools root 2740 1 0 Dec09 ? 00:00:42 /usr/sbin/vmtoolsd # service vmware-tools status vmware-guestd is running
How to start up VMware Tools:
# service vmware-tools start # service vmware-tools status # service vmware-tools start Checking acpi hot plug [ OK ] Starting VMware Tools services in the virtual machine: Switching to guest configuration: [ OK ] Paravirtual SCSI module: [ OK ] Guest memory manager: [ OK ] Driver for the VMXNET 3 virtual network card: [ OK ] VM communication interface: [ OK ] VM communication interface socket family: [ OK ] Guest operating system daemon: [ OK ] # service vmware-tools status vmware-guestd is running
If you are using Red Hat Enterprise Linux Server 6 or later
How to check VMware Tools status:
# ps -ef | grep vmtools # status vmware-tools # ps -ef | grep vmtools root 1274 1 0 10:19 ? 00:00:03 /usr/sbin/vmtoolsd # status vmware-tools vmware-tools start/running
How to start up VMware Tools:
# start vmware-tools # status vmware-tools # start vmware-tools vmware-tools start/running # status vmware-tools vmware-tools start/running
